On 11/01/2024 11:30, axe cometh wrote:
> THE SCOOP
> Google is laying off hundreds of people working on its voice-activated
> Google Assistant software and eliminating a similar number of roles on its
> knowledge and information product teams, a Google spokesperson confirmed
> to Semafor on Wednesday.
>
> Google told Semafor the restructuring would help improve Google Assistant
> as it explores integrating newer artificial intelligence technology into
> its products. The company announced in October that it was using its
> generative AI chatbot Bard to build a new version of Google Assistant that
> “extends beyond voice, understands and adapts to you and handles personal
> tasks in new ways.”
>
> Google has been making periodic job cuts over the past year, including in
> its recruiting and news divisions, but it has not conducted company-wide
> layoffs since last January, when it eliminated approximately 12,000 roles.
> Its parent Alphabet reported having over 180,000 employees as of September
> 2023.
>
> Title iconKNOW MORE
> Google Assistant debuted in 2016 to compete with Amazon’s Alexa and
> Apple’s Siri, and together, the three voice assistants defined the first
> wave of mainstream question-and-answer products powered by artificial
> intelligence.
>
> Over the past year, large language models — the tech behind OpenAI’s
> ChatGPT and similar tools — have transformed the market, and tech giants
> are now figuring out the best ways to integrate them into existing product
> lines.
>
> Title iconNOTABLE
> Google is also planning to restructure its 30,000-person advertising sales
> department, prompting anxiety about job cuts, The Information reported.
> The new Bard-idified Google Assistant has yet to be released, but
> 9to5Google has an overview of several new features reportedly coming to
> Android phones.
